Program Report – Embroidery Machines & Tarpaulin Donation

Date: 08-08-2025
Location: Kamareddy District

Event Overview

On 8th August 2025, a meaningful social welfare program was organized to support farmers and empower rural women through skill-development and livelihood enhancement. The event was jointly facilitated by Global Rotary Club and People For India.

During the program, Embroidery Machines and Tarpaulins were donated to beneficiaries. Additionally, scholarship support was extended to students under the Rajshree Scholarship initiative.

Donations & Contributions
1. Global Rotary Club

Donated Embroidery Machines to support rural women in earning a sustainable income.

2. Rama Devi & Sudhakar Gupta Yadiki – Rajshree Scholarship

Sponsored Rajshree Scholarship for deserving students to encourage higher education.

3. Suraj Pabbathi

Donated Tarpaulins to farmers to support agricultural needs, especially during monsoon seasons.
